I have my S2k about a year and 5k miles ago. Is a 2001 full stock car. I track it in a small go-kart track about 6 times a year.
About three months ago I have notice an increase amount of the freeplay of the clutch. I put a braided line and bleed the system. The engage work better and feels better but freeplay was still increasing. Today I 've change the master and slave and obviously bleed the system again. The freeplay seems too much. About two inches or more. From top to bottom the travel is the same but engagemnet of the clutch is very down a freeplay is two inches or more. Any suggestions?

Seems like you have an air pocket. Even if you bleed the slave till you are blue in the face, a pocket of air will remain in the slave.
Unbolt the slave, point the bleeder straight up, and open it. You will see you air bubbles come right out, then solid fluid. Close it fast as to not let it run dry.
